Superdupont is a superhero from the French comic book series Superdupont and a satire of French nationalist attitudes.
Origin[]
Superdupont was the son of a soldier buried under the Arc de Triomphe who dedicated his life to battling the forces of Anti-France. Other than that, the origin of his powers are unknown.
Biography[]
Superdupont's past is largely unknown, save that it is known that he was the son of a soldier buried under the Arc de Triomphe. He is known for being extremely patriotic and battles an evil organization known as Anti-France, who seek to destroy France and French culture.
